Mathew Battle (died 1668/69), a son of William Battel and Margaret Dukes, was born in England. He immigrated to Virginia in 1647, and married his wife, Anne (date unknown), apparently after his arrival in America. They had three known children. Many descendants live in the southeastern United States, and in Texas and adjacent states.

Family history and genealogical information about the descendants of William Joiner who was born ca. 1680 and immigrated to America from Wales or the Isle of Jersey, England. He married Elizabeth Eades 15 July 1718 in New London, Connecticut. Later they moved to East Haddam, Connecticut and were the parents of three known children. Descendants lived in New England, New York, Illinois, Wisconsin, Colorado, California and elsewhere.

Robert Leuty was born ca. 1771 at Hook (Rock), Yorkshire, England. He married Sarah Mann (1779-1852) in 1801. They had eight children. Robert died in 1849 in Snaith, Yorkshire, England. Traces the descendants of their children who immigrated to the United States. Joseph and William immigrated ca. 1828 and eventually settled in Ohio. William later moved to Indiana. Hannah immigrated with her husband, John Neville, in 1834 and settled in Ohio....
